Can Dogs Have Shredded Wheat?
Shredded wheat is a popular breakfast cereal for humans, but can our canine companions enjoy it too? The answer is a bit complicated. While shredded wheat itself isn’t toxic to dogs, there are some important factors to consider before offering it to your furry friend.
Nutritional Content of Shredded Wheat
Shredded wheat is primarily made from whole wheat, which provides some nutritional benefits. It contains:
- Fiber: Good for digestion
- Carbohydrates: Provide energy
- Some vitamins and minerals
However, it’s relatively low in protein and fat, which are essential nutrients for dogs. (See Also: Do Australian Cattle Dogs Have Webbed Feet)
Potential Concerns with Feeding Shredded Wheat to Dogs
High in Carbohydrates
Shredded wheat is high in carbohydrates, which can lead to weight gain and blood sugar spikes in dogs, especially if they are already prone to these issues.
Lack of Essential Nutrients
As mentioned, shredded wheat lacks sufficient protein and fat, which are crucial for a dog’s overall health and well-being. A diet lacking these nutrients can lead to muscle loss, skin problems, and other health concerns.
Added Sugar and Flavorings
Some brands of shredded wheat may contain added sugar, artificial flavors, or other ingredients that are not suitable for dogs. Always check the ingredient list carefully before offering any human food to your pet.
Choking Hazard
The small, dry pieces of shredded wheat can pose a choking hazard for dogs, especially small breeds. It’s important to supervise your dog closely when they are eating shredded wheat and to make sure they are chewing it properly.

Frequently Asked Questions About Shredded Wheat for Dogs
Is Shredded Wheat safe for dogs?
Shredded wheat itself is not toxic to dogs. It’s made from whole wheat and doesn’t contain any harmful ingredients. However, it’s important to remember that it’s not a complete or balanced diet for dogs.
Can shredded wheat upset my dog’s stomach?
Some dogs may experience digestive upset after eating shredded wheat, especially if they are not used to it. It’s high in fiber, which can cause diarrhea or gas in some dogs. Start with a small amount and monitor your dog’s reaction.
How much shredded wheat can I give my dog?
As a treat, a small amount of shredded wheat (about a teaspoon or two) is generally safe for most dogs. However, it’s best to consult with your veterinarian about the appropriate amount for your dog based on their size, breed, and health condition. (See Also: Why Is My Dog Scared All Of A Sudden)
